Cost of Living in Wavre vs Manchester

Cost of living in Wavre is 14% lower than in Manchester (without rent).

Rent in Wavre is 41% cheaper than in Manchester.

Cost of living including rent in Wavre is 32% lower than in Manchester.

Food in Wavre is 16% cheaper than in Manchester.

Transport in Wavre is 35% more expensive than in Manchester.
